Eva Green

EVA GREEN (Serafina Pekkala) made her film debut in Oscar®-winning director Bernardo Bertolucci’s critically acclaimed The Dreamers, a triangular love story set against the Paris riots of 1968, starring opposite Michael Pitt and Louis Garrel.

Born in Paris, Green studied at the St. Paul Drama School. This was followed by a course at the London Weber Douglas Academy of Dramatic Art.

She began her acting career on stage, appearing in 2001 in two plays: “Turceret” directed by Gerard Descartes, and “Jalousie En Trois Fax” directed by Didier Long. The latter was highly acclaimed and earned her a nomination for Les Molieres, France’s most prestigious theatre award, in the category of Best Female Newcomer.

In 2004, she starred alongside Kristin Scott Thomas and Romain Duris in Jean-Paul Salome’s French-language film Arsène Lupin and, in 2005, she made her Hollywood film debut as the female lead in Ridley’s Scott’s Crusades epic Kingdom of Heaven with Orlando Bloom and Liam Neeson.

She most recently starred opposite her co-star from The Golden Compass, Daniel Craig, in Casino Royale, in which she played Treasury officer Vesper Lynd. She recently completed filming Franklyn, directed by Gerald McMorrow, which is set in futuristic London.

Green was presented with the Rising Star Award from BAFTA in 2007, following her performance in Casino Royale.
